L. speciosum Top Size Speciosum translated means “good looking,” “showy,” “splendid” and “brilliant,” all aptly describing what many consider to be the most beautiful of all Oriental lily spe- cies. Once established it will grow up to 6 feet tall and bear as many as 30 richly fragrant, pendant, 6 inch flowers. Twisting, recurving tepals nearly meet at the back of the bloom while the prominent stamens thrust forward. One of the last lilies to flower putting on a fabulous display in August and September. Prefers humus rich, acid soil. From Japan, introduced in 1832.


[Ht: 3'-6', Bl: Aug/Sept, Zones: 4 to 8, S/SSH]

L. Stargazer #SLY58 Size: 16/18cm Stargazer is perhaps the most famous of all lilies. Introduced over 25 years ago by renowned lily breeder Leslie Woodriff, it was the first of the modern Oriental Hybrid lilies and still is the most widely grown, both in the garden and for the floral trade. Its large, upfacing, crimson-red flowers are embellished with darker spots and crisp white margins, held on sturdy stems. Compact plants are perfect for the garden or containers. L. tigrinum var. splendens #SLY40 Size: 18/20cm “Tiger Lily.” A robust stem-rooting lily native to China, Korea and Japan familiar for its generous flowerheads of unscented, recurved, 5 inch, orange-red flowers decorated with dark purple spots. Has dark purple hairy stems scat- tered with lance-shaped leaves and noticeable purplish-black bulbils in the upper leaf axils. Easy to grow, thriving with minimal care. Very virus tolerant, but can be a virus carrier without showing symptoms so should be grown away from other lilies. One of the oldest lilies in cultivation, introduced in 1804. L. var. White Henry #SLY42 Size: 18cm/up A Woodriff cultivar (L. henryi x L. leucanthum centifolium) held in high esteem since its introduction in 1945. A sunburst-type, its white trumpet flowers are highlighted with vivid orange throats and delicate cinnamon-colored flecks that radiate into the white. L. wallichianum #SLY29 Top Size


Native to the Himalayas, this late flowering species bears up to 4 exceptionally fragrant, outward-facing slender white trumpets with a suggestion of green. Each petal is 6 to 12 inches long resulting in blooms of spectacular size. A real character, this plant produces stem bulbils underground and tends to wander, creating some surprises when the stem often comes up some distance from where the bulb was planted.
